Echoes of Yesterday: A Deep Dive into the Charm of Classic Cars

Classic cars – more than just nostalgic relics – represent a fascinating intersection of engineering, design, and the enduring spirit of automotive innovation. This post explores the key characteristics, history, and appeal of these timeless vehicles, offering a glimpse into a world of both grandeur and a unique connection to the past.

“Beyond aesthetics, classic cars possess a distinct set of characteristics that contribute to their enduring appeal. These include:

  • Era-Specific Design: Each era of a car is visually defined by its particular styling cues – from the flowing lines of a 1920s roadster to the sculpted bodywork of a 1960s sports car.

  • Engine Technology: Early models often utilized simpler, more reliable engines that favored higher horsepower and smoother operation. Modern classics often boast bespoke or racing-inspired engines that exemplify technological advancement.

  • Materials & Craftsmanship: Classic cars frequently feature higher quality materials – leather upholstery, hand-stitched details, and durable construction – which speaks to a level of care and attention to quality often absent in mass-produced vehicles.

  • Unique Features: Many classic cars were custom built, or feature unique features such as hand-painted designs, special trim options, or innovative safety features that were unique to the time.

“Collecting classic cars isn’t simply about preserving historical vehicles; it's about a passionate community, a deep appreciation for engineering, and a connection to a significant period of automotive history. The rarity, provenance, and overall condition of a classic can be highly prized. Collectors seek to understand the history behind a particular model and to build a collection that represents a particular era or design. It's a pursuit of legacy and a testament to the artistry of automotive engineering.”
